Why do Christians need to respond to genetic engineering?

A
  • Science and tech pose ethical questions that cannot be easily answered. Christianity has a role in assessing the morality of scientific developments that could cause harm.
  • Just because something can be done, doesn’t mean it should be done in terms of scientific progress or development. Christianity gives general moral systems although these need to be applied through reason to issues in modern science.
  • ‘While Christians can make personal decisions based on their faith, they can only extend ethical decisions to justify them using reason.’- Dame Mary Woodcock, claiming religious beliefs on society-wide ethical issues must be paired with reason.
  • Other Christians point to science and reason as God given abilities. Respect for life should lead Christians to use that ability to the greatest extent possible to preserve life. God would not have given humans the ability to engage in genetic engineering if he didn’t want them to use it.

What is genetic engineering?

A
  • Genetic engineering aims to engineer a unique set of genes in humans, animals and plants. To do that, genes can be exchanged between different species.
  • Genetic engineering works by using enzymes to extract pieces of DNA and inserting the DNA into a gap in the DNA of another organism.
  1. Human genetic engineering
    - Human genome project is an attempt to map out all human chromosomes.

BENEFIT: Would give us the ability to isolate genes responsible for genetic diseases like Alzheimer’s.
RISK: Having such knowledge requires great responsibility because genetic engineering has the potential to change humans and plant and animal genes, which can be transferred within species.

  1. Genetic Modification of humans, animals and plants
    - Genetically modified crops are resistant to disease and insect attacks.
    - Humans produce bacteria that make insulin quickly for diabetics.

What is the potential for GE?
- To treat conditions like Alzheimer’s and cystic fibrosis.
- To engineer children to have certain improved characteristics, such as as intelligence and appearance.
- This may lead to the production of ‘transhumans’, engineered humans who have advanced physical, mental and physical powers.
